Output 289758746de20b38d27894a9536cbf4cf87d83c3295f6416a3560ea83914782b:61

value
400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be158915beab12a2f467810d85b9d8b2124e3f25 OP_EQUAL
address
3K267JZ9LHET4w8cBEUQnKjucC6nmrJEbw
transaction
289758746de20b38d27894a9536cbf4cf87d83c3295f6416a3560ea83914782b
spent
true